open a directory section -- files and folders. edit a file. save it.
it gets saved to both the local hard drive and the server at the same
time. edit another file, save it, it gets saved to local drive and
server, etc. possible with bbedit 10 ?

I used to have an AppleScript attached to the Save menu item which would upload (FTP) files to remote server every time they were saved. I stopped using that years ago in favour of ExpanDrive.

I can share the AppleScript if you're interested, but it was very specific to my setup and workflow.
